In municipal settings, cloud storage is no longer passive. It requires 2U or 4U rack servers with massive SATA HDD capacity (up to 20TB per drive) and integrated GPU acceleration to process thousands of video streams in real-time for traffic management and public safety.
Global banks require localized storage clusters that comply with GDPR or local data residency laws. Our xFusion 2288H V6 systems provide the redundancy and encryption needed for secure, on-premise private clouds that sync with global infrastructure.
For research labs, the bottleneck is often I/O throughput. By utilizing DDR5 RDIMM memory and RAID-optimized boot cards (like the XP270-M2), we enable researchers to feed data to GPU clusters at 10Gbps+ speeds, significantly reducing training time for large language models.
